TuesdayEcclesiastes 5:10-12
Solomon, the writer of Ecclesiastes, enjoyed all the good things life had to offer, including an overabundance of wealth. Even with those things, he looked back and acknowledged the futility of chasing after them. John D. Rockefeller was asked, “How much money does it take to satisfy a man?” Rockefeller replied, “Just a little bit more than he has.” Money falsely promises many things that many people find desirable—security, comfort, and status to name a few. The problem is there is never seemingly enough money to fulfill our desires. Often, where money increases, so do expenses, responsibilities, and even unintended problems. When money, or anything for that matter, is elevated to an ultimate status in our lives, it ends up mastering us. Money can never satisfy what we can only find in God.
